Kanji Detail for 容 - "contain, accept, appearance"

  • Meaning

    容 means "contain, accept, appearance."

    1. Contain - To hold inside; to accommodate.

    2. Accept - To receive; to permit.

    3. Appearance - The outward look; form.

    4. Easy - Simple; not difficult.

    XSZD Xuéshēng Zìdiǎn (學生字典) - Student's Dictionary

    To receive; to contain. Such as 休休有容, meaning one's capacity is great enough to accommodate many. The amount a container can hold is called 容量. | Appearance. One's manner is called 容止. Beautiful looks are called 玉容. Getting a haircut is called 整容. Also, being composed without losing composure is called 從容. Describing the state of things is called 形容. | A particle. Such as "no need" is 無容; "need not" is 不容. | Perhaps. Such as 容或有之.
